This position is for a Principal Software Engineer at Reprise, located in the United States.
The role involves working in a modern full-stack environment to deliver high-quality software for complex web applications.
Responsibilities include developing and maintaining core features across frontend (JavaScript/TypeScript frameworks) and backend (Django, cloud services) components.
The engineer will collaborate closely with cross-functional teams, including product and design, to deliver high-impact solutions.
The position requires building, testing, and deploying production-quality code using continuous integration and test-driven development practices.
Mentoring and coaching junior engineers is a key aspect of the role, fostering a culture of learning and technical excellence.
The engineer must adapt rapidly to evolving technical requirements and startup priorities, balancing speed and quality.
The role includes working on cutting-edge frontend tools such as Chrome APIs and virtual DOM frameworks to enhance user experience.
Requirements:
A Bachelor’s degree in Computer Science or a related field is required, with a Master’s preferred.
Candidates must have 7+ years of professional software engineering experience.
Strong proficiency in frontend technologies is required, with experience in modern JavaScript frameworks like Vue, React, or Angular.
Experience with backend frameworks such as Django or Flask is necessary.
Candidates should be comfortable working across the full stack, with a primary focus on frontend development.
Excellent communication skills and experience in collaborative, team-oriented environments are essential.
The ability to mentor and guide junior team members effectively is required.
Candidates must demonstrate agility and enthusiasm for working in fast-paced startup settings.
Benefits:
The position offers a competitive salary aligned with market standards.
There is a flexible vacation policy that includes three-day weekends each month.
Comprehensive health, vision, and dental insurance options are provided, including FSA/HSA plans.
Paid parental leave is available.
A 401(k) retirement plan is offered.
Long and short-term disability insurance is included.
The work environment is fully remote, within the U.S. East Coast time zone.
Employees have access to a WeWork All Access membership.
There is an opportunity to work with a seasoned team experienced in multiple startups.